Understanding French Press Coffee
French press coffee, also known as cafetière or coffee press, is a brewing method that involves steeping coarse coffee grounds in hot water and then pressing the grounds to the bottom of the container to separate the liquid. This method is known for producing a rich, full-bodied coffee with a heavier body and more oils than other brewing methods. But what does this have to do with caffeine content? To answer this question, we need to delve into the world of caffeine extraction.
Caffeine Extraction: The Science Behind the Buzz
Caffeine extraction is the process by which caffeine is released from coffee beans into the liquid. The amount of caffeine extracted depends on several factors, including the type of coffee bean, the grind size, the water temperature, and the brewing time. In general, the longer the brewing time and the hotter the water, the more caffeine is extracted. French press coffee, with its longer brewing time and coarser grind, would seem to be a prime candidate for high caffeine extraction. But is this really the case?
The Role of Grind Size and Brewing Time
The grind size of the coffee beans plays a crucial role in caffeine extraction. A coarser grind, like that used in French press coffee, allows for a slower and more evenly paced extraction. This can result in a more balanced flavor and a higher caffeine content. However, the brewing time also plays a critical role. French press coffee typically has a brewing time of around 4-5 minutes, which is longer than other brewing methods like drip coffee or espresso. This longer brewing time allows for more caffeine to be extracted from the beans, but it also depends on the ratio of coffee to water.

Factors Affecting Caffeine Content
There are several factors that can affect the caffeine content of French press coffee, including the type of coffee bean, the roast level, and the ratio of coffee to water. Dark roast coffee beans, for example, tend to have a lower caffeine content than light roast beans, while a higher ratio of coffee to water can result in a more concentrated brew with a higher caffeine content. Additionally, the age of the coffee beans can also play a role, with fresher beans tend to have a higher caffeine content.

How does the caffeine content of French press coffee compare to espresso?
The caffeine content of French press coffee is generally lower than that of espresso, despite the fact that French press coffee can have a bolder and more intense flavor. A typical 1-ounce shot of espresso can have anywhere from 60 to 75 milligrams of caffeine, which is a higher concentration of caffeine per ounce than French press coffee. However, it’s worth noting that espresso is typically consumed in much smaller quantities than French press coffee, so the total amount of caffeine consumed may be similar.
The difference in caffeine content between French press coffee and espresso is due to the different brewing methods used. Espresso is made by forcing pressurized hot water through finely ground coffee beans, which results in a highly concentrated and caffeinated beverage. French press coffee, on the other hand, is made by steeping coarse coffee grounds in hot water, which results in a more balanced and nuanced flavor. How does the type of coffee bean affect the caffeine content of French press coffee?
The type of coffee bean used can have a significant impact on the caffeine content of French press coffee. Arabica beans, for example, generally have a lower caffeine content than Robusta beans. Arabica beans typically have around 0.8-1.2% caffeine content, while Robusta beans can have up to 2% caffeine content. The caffeine content can also vary depending on the region and farm where the coffee beans are grown, as well as the processing and roasting methods used.
The roast level of the coffee beans can also affect the caffeine content of French press coffee. Lighter roasts tend to have a higher caffeine content than darker roasts, as some of the caffeine is lost during the roasting process. However, the difference in caffeine content between light and dark roasts is relatively small, and other factors such as the brewing method and coffee-to-water ratio can have a much greater impact on the final caffeine content of the coffee.
